HELPLESS IN SPACE
Randall stopped short and Captain Stark
stared. They both felt a steady throbbing in the berylumin floor of the
ethership’s navigating cabin. It was an alien pulsation, a steady beat of
uniform pattern and intensity.
Captain Stark’s face showed alarm and
puzzlement. “What is it, Randall?”
“Whatever it is, it’s coming from outside the
ship,” he muttered, busying himself with the glittering array of instruments.
The Captain fidgeted and chewed his mustache
as Randall worked.
He finally looked up from the instruments,
his face expressionless. “We’ve been caught up by a cosmic ray stream fifteen
hundred miles wide. Its hold is unbreakable. We’ll just have to let it take us
where it will.”
“Impossible!” the Captain roared. “We must be
able to pull out.” He stomped to the engine room optophone and bellowed,
“Maximum acceleration on neutrino power! No rocket ignition until ordered.”
Randall froze. “I warn you,” he blurted,
“don’t waste any rocket fuel. We’ll need it for landing—somewhere.”
